Tommy Giraux - Technology's Role in Transforming Hospitality Operations

from Captive Conversations, The Hospitality Podcast · host CaptiveWiFI.com

What if the key to revolutionising your hospitality business lies in real-time data and technology integration? Join us as we sit down with Tommy from Honest Burgers, a hospitality veteran with over a decade of experience, to uncover the secrets behind this transformation. From the shift away from end-of-month reports to leveraging live data for enhanced decision-making, Tommy shares invaluable insights on optimizing essential metrics like sales, guest satisfaction, and average spend per head. We also dive into the tech stack versus single supplier debate, where Tommy's thoughtful analysis will help you make informed tech decisions tailored to your business needs. We then explore the evolving landscape of hospitality technology and its synergy with personalised service. Tommy also highlights the dynamic restaurant scene in London, emphasizing the importance of maintaining a human connection in an increasingly digital world. Learn about key partners and emerging platforms in hospitality tech that are setting new benchmarks for innovation and customer engagement. Tommy’s journey from Costa to Itsu and finally Honest Burgers is nothing short of inspiring. We delve into the challenges and triumphs of his career, from managing large-scale operations to spearheading new site openings at Honest Burgers. Listen as he recounts the brand's commitment to quality, culture, and community engagement. We also discuss the impact of AI in hospitality, the integration of various technologies into customer experiences, and the power of networking in the industry. This episode is a treasure trove of practical advice and inspirational stories for anyone passionate about hospitality and innovation.
